Hello,

I am using OCS and I am using a custom Desktop. My desktop, on recordprocess event, update a custom field of my dialing list. I am trying to use a filter on CCPulse on the recordcompleted statistic. But whatever the value is, the recordcompleted statitic is counting every record, regardless the filter. Is it possible to use a filter ont that statictic

  • Hi,

    the event you are using is actually issued by OCS and not StatServer, therefore filters would not work, because they are either on StatServer or CCP.

    Are you trying to get stats on desktop or on CCP?

    David,

    I agree with Vic that the Recordcompleted is not a statistic that StatServer/CCPulse can report with. Depending on what you want to achieve, you can apply various Filters to the ResponseType etc. by applyuing them in your StatServer>Options>Filters. See your OCS/StatServer documents for more information...
